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2010.08.27;
Скачать: CL | DM;

Вниз

как добавить поле в индифицирующую колонку   Найти похожие ветки 

 
FIL-23   (2010-05-08 14:58) [0]

вопрос такой, есть таблица на сервере ms sql2000, в этой таблице есть ключевое поле с автоинкриментом. Когда я добавляю запись id у нее становится например 5 потом 6 ,7,8,9 и т.д. ... а если я хочу удалить запись 7...а потом когда мне надо будет через некоторое время вставить в нее чтонибудь... как это реализовать. Я прочел что с помощью тригеров. Может быть есть более интересный вариант использующий только функции delphi?


 
DVM ©   (2010-05-08 15:15) [1]

зачем это надо? ключ имхо он на то и есть ключ чтобы однозначно что-то идентифицировать.


 
FIL-23   (2010-05-08 15:29) [2]

а если вот надо и все тут ... всеравно же поля нету 7го ... значит чтото можно вставить вот например есть такая команда  SET IDENTITY_INSERT имя_таблицы ON  При помощи этого оператора можно вставить строку и назначить нужное вам значение идентифицирующей колонки. Закончив ввод строки, нужно отменить возможность вставки в идентифицирующую колонку при помощи такого оператора:  но это непосредственно в ms sql2000


 
Плохиш ©   (2010-05-08 15:42) [3]


> FIL-23   (08.05.10 15:29) [2]
>
> а если вот надо и все тут ...

Дебильные задачи решаются всякими дерьмокодерами самостоятельно.



Страницы: 1 вся ветка

Текущий архив: 2010.08.27;
Скачать: CL | DM;

Наверх




Память: 0.47 MB
Время: 0.048 c
15-1264348823
xayam
2010-01-24 19:00
2010.08.27
Подскажите как называется мелодия


2-1271748779
Дмитрий. М
2010-04-20 11:32
2010.08.27
Почему ругается компилятор?


15-1270622334
Мимо не прошел
2010-04-07 10:38
2010.08.27
отделить шум от голоса в мп3 подручными средствами


15-1267574302
DillerXX
2010-03-03 02:58
2010.08.27
Может тут мне помогут с вопросом о модеме?


2-1272475993
DROWSY
2010-04-28 21:33
2010.08.27
редактирование в гриде.